Chemical Identifiers

CAS 112-58-3
Molecular Formula C12H26O
Molecular Weight (g/mol) 186.34
MDL Number MFCD00009525
InChI Key BPIUIOXAFBGMNB-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Synonym dihexyl ether, hexyl ether, hexane, 1,1'-oxybis, n-hexyl ether, di-n-hexyl ether, ether, dihexyl, bis 1-hexyl ether, 1,1'-oxybis hexane, 1-hexyloxy hexane
PubChem CID 8198
SMILES CCCCCCOCCCCCC

Description

Description

Dihexyl ether has been used as: supported liquid membrane during hollow-fiber liquid-phase microextraction method for determination of nitrophenolic compounds from atmospheric aerosol particles, an extraction solvent to detect avermectins in stream water by hollow-fiber-assisted liquid-phase microextraction technique coupled with LC-MS/MS.
